php移动端网页怎么写
-
在编写移动端网页时,需要注意以下几个方面:
1. 响应式布局:移动端网页需要适应不同屏幕大小的设备,因此使用响应式布局是必要的。可以使用CSS媒体查询或者框架如Bootstrap来实现。
2. 简洁明了的导航:在移动设备上屏幕空间有限,导航要简洁明了,尽量使用图标代替文字,确保用户能够快速找到需要的信息。
3. 优化加载速度:移动设备的网络速度相对较慢,因此需要优化网页的加载速度。可以通过压缩代码、合并请求、使用CDN等方式来提升加载速度。
4. 简化输入:移动设备的键盘输入相对麻烦,可以通过使用自动填充、下拉选择等方式来简化用户输入。
5. 使用合适的字体大小和行距:移动设备屏幕较小,字体大小和行距要合适,保证用户能够清楚地阅读内容,不需要缩放页面。
6. 触摸友好的操作:移动设备通过触摸屏进行操作,因此要考虑按钮大小、间距和点击区域,使操作更加友好。
7. 考虑不同网络环境:移动设备经常在不同的网络环境下使用,要考虑到网络不稳定的情况,例如在加载大图或视频时提供缓冲功能。
8. 测试适配性:移动设备种类繁多,要确保网页在不同设备上的适配性和兼容性,进行多设备测试。
总结起来,移动端网页要注重响应式布局、简洁明了的导航、优化加载速度、简化输入、合适的字体大小和行距、触摸友好的操作、考虑不同网络环境以及测试适配性。通过以上几点的注意,可以编写出适合移动设备的网页。
2年前 -
移动端网页设计是为了适应手机和平板等移动设备而进行优化的网页设计。相比传统的桌面端网页设计,移动端网页有其独特的特点和要求。下面是关于如何写移动端网页的几点要点。
1. 响应式设计:移动端网页要具备响应式设计,即能够根据不同的屏幕尺寸和设备自动调整布局和内容展示。这样用户就可以在不同尺寸的设备上获得良好的浏览体验,无论是大屏手机还是平板设备。
2. 简洁明了的布局:移动设备屏幕较小,所以在移动端网页设计中要保持简洁明了的布局,尽量避免过多的内容和元素堆砌。合理的排版和布局可以提升用户的浏览体验,让用户更快地找到所需信息。
3. 精简图片和动画:移动设备的网络速度有限,加载大量的图片和动画会消耗用户的流量和时间。因此,在移动端网页设计中要避免使用过多的图片和动画,尽量使用精简的图标和简单的动效,以提升页面的加载速度和用户体验。
4. 易于操作的交互元素:用户在移动设备上操作的方式与在桌面设备上有所区别,所以在移动端网页设计中要注意将交互元素放置在易于点击的区域,以便用户方便地进行点击和滑动操作。同时,也要考虑到手指的大小,留出足够的点击区域。
5. 设备兼容性:移动设备市场多样化,有各种不同的设备和操作系统。在移动端网页设计中,要确保网页在不同的设备和浏览器上能够正常显示和运行,避免出现布局错乱、内容显示异常等问题。
综上所述,移动端网页设计需要考虑响应式设计、简洁明了的布局、精简图片和动画、易于操作的交互元素以及设备兼容性等要点。只有考虑到这些方面,才能设计出适应移动设备的优质网页,给用户带来良好的浏览体验。
2年前 -
编写移动端网页涉及以下几个方面的内容:
1. 响应式设计:移动端网页需要适配不同的屏幕尺寸,响应式设计是必不可少的。可以使用媒体查询、弹性布局等技术实现网页在不同屏幕尺寸下的自适应。
2. 移动优先:由于移动设备的限制,移动端网页需要考虑页面加载速度、交互方式等因素。可以通过优化图片、合并和压缩CSS和JavaScript等方式提高网页性能。
3. 触摸事件:移动设备大多是通过触摸屏进行交互,因此需要针对触摸操作进行相应的设计。常见的触摸事件包括点击、滑动、双指缩放等,可以通过JavaScript监听这些事件,并进行相应的处理。
4. 导航和菜单:移动端网页通常采用折叠式菜单或底部导航栏来展示导航。可以使用HTML和CSS实现这些功能,并结合JavaScript实现交互效果。
5. 表单设计:移动设备的输入方式通常是虚拟键盘,对于表单的设计需要更加注重用户体验。可以使用HTML5提供的表单属性和事件来增强用户输入的便捷性。
6. 图标和图片:移动端网页中常常使用图标和图片来增加用户的视觉享受。可以使用CSS Sprite技术来合并图片,减少HTTP请求次数,并使用矢量图标来适应不同的屏幕分辨率。
7. 流畅的滚动和动画效果:移动设备的滚动和动画效果对于用户体验至关重要。可以使用CSS或JavaScript库实现流畅的滚动和动画效果,提升网页的交互性和吸引力。
以上是移动端网页编写的一些基本要点和技巧。根据这些要点,可以结合具体需求和设计稿,按照以下步骤编写移动端网页:
1. 创建HTML文档,编写基本的页面结构和内容。
2. 使用CSS样式对页面进行美化和排版,包括字体、颜色、边框等样式设置。
3. 使用媒体查询或弹性布局来实现响应式设计,确保网页在不同屏幕尺寸下正常显示。
4. 添加JavaScript代码,实现触摸事件的监听和处理,以及其他交互功能的实现。
5. 添加表单,并针对输入方式进行优化,如使用HTML5表单属性和事件,提升用户体验。
6. 如果需要使用图标和图片,可以使用CSS Sprite合并图片,以及使用矢量图标来适应不同的屏幕分辨率。
7. 如果需要滚动和动画效果,可以使用CSS或JavaScript库来实现,确保网页的交互性和吸引力。
8. 最后,进行兼容性测试,确保网页在不同设备和浏览器下正常工作。以上是一种编写移动端网页的方法和操作流程,根据实际情况和需求可以进行相应的调整和扩展。
2年前